Glossary Digital Twin
When you hear the term digital twin, you might wonder what it truly means. At its core, a digital twin is a virtual representation of a physical object or system, designed to simulate its performance and behavior in real-time. This technology has found applications in various sectors, including manufacturing, healthcare, and even smart Cities. How Digital Twins Work
A digital twin operates by continually collecting data from its physical counterpart using sensors and the Internet of Things (IoT) technology. This data is processed and analyzed, allowing businesses to replicate real-world behaviors and conditions in a virtual environment. By examining real-time data, companies can simulate outcomes with incredible accuracy.
For example, lets say youre responsible for a delivery fleet. By employing a digital twin of your fleet, you can monitor fuel consumption, driver behavior, and vehicle diagnostics in real-time. This allows you to identify inefficiencies, such as underperforming routes or vehicles that require urgent maintenance, all of which can help in making data-driven decisions that save time and resources.

Real-World Examples of Digital Twin Applications
Thinking about practical applications, consider the healthcare sector. Hospitals are increasingly utilizing digital twins to optimize patient management systems. By creating a digital twin of the patient journey, providers can monitor and improve patient flow, reduce waiting times, and enhance overall care.
Another exCiting development is in urban planning. Cities are using digital twin technology to simulate traffic patterns and public transport systems. This practice allows city planners to test various scenarios before implementing changes, ultimately leading to smarter urban development and improved public services.
Challenges to Implementing Digital Twins
While the benefits of a glossary digital twin are immense, it comes with its challenges. Implementing this technology requires not only significant investment but also a cultural shift within organizations. Teams must be open to adapting their workflows based on insights gained from digital twins, which can be a considerable hindrance for some businesses.
Another challenge lies in data security. As companies collect vast amounts of data to feed into their digital twins, safeguarding that data becomes paramount. Organizations must be vigilant in protecting sensitive information from breaches, which means implementing cutting-edge security measures and ensuring compliance with relevant regulations.
